At a Glance

St. Thomas University is a small private nonprofit university in Miami Gardens, FL. Approximately 2,214 undergraduates are enrolled. Admissions are accessible with a 98% acceptance rate. The campus sits in a beach town, just 8 miles from the ocean. Greek life is active on campus. CollegeCove's campus safety score is 73/100 (Pretty Safe), based on U.S. Department of Education Clery Act data.

Greek Life at St. Thomas University

At St. Thomas University, 8% of men are in a fraternity and 10% of women are in a sorority. That is a modest Greek presence. Chapters are active, but most students are not affiliated. Figures come from the institution’s reported Greek system data. Recruitment timing and chapter counts vary year to year, so check the student life office for the current season.

Frequently Asked Questions

Where is St. Thomas University located?

St. Thomas University is located in Miami Gardens, FL. The main campus address is 16401 NW 37th Ave, Miami Gardens, FL. It is a private institution offering 4-year degree programs.

What is the acceptance rate at St. Thomas University?

St. Thomas University has an acceptance rate of 98%, making it accessible. Out of 7,095 applicants, 6,947 were admitted in the most recent year. 2,214 enrolled.

How many students attend St. Thomas University?

St. Thomas University enrolls 2,214 undergraduates. That figure counts degree-seeking undergraduate students across all years, not just the incoming class, and it excludes graduate students. Source: U.S. Department of Education College Scorecard.
